Aquatic Foods Inc. operates in a very different space than your typical dry pet food manufacturer. This is not a brand built on traditional kibble formulas for dogs and cats. Instead, it carves out a niche in the world of high-purity, aquatic-based supplements, primarily targeting owners of exotic pets like large fish and turtles, with a notable crossover into the feline treat market. The company's philosophy appears centered on delivering single-ingredient, minimally processed nutrition. The product currently in our catalog—freeze-dried krill—is a perfect example. This isn't a complex blend of ingredients but rather whole organisms, preserved to maintain their nutritional integrity and natural appeal. Marketed for a fascinatingly wide array of animals, from Arowanas and Cichlids to aquatic turtles and even domestic cats, this product underscores the brand's focus on foundational, natural food sources. This specialization comes at a significant cost. With an average price of $38.75 per pound, Aquatic Foods Inc. is one of the most premium options in our catalog, far exceeding the overall category average of $22.43/lb. This price point is not comparable to standard dry kibble, as the product is not a milled and extruded food. The cost is driven by the sourcing of whole krill and the energy-intensive freeze-drying process, which removes water while preserving the delicate fats, proteins, and in the case of krill, the color-enhancing antioxidant Astaxanthin. So, who is this brand for? It is decidedly not for the pet owner seeking a budget-friendly, all-in-one meal. Aquatic Foods Inc. appeals to the discerning hobbyist—the owner of prized "monster fish" or the cat parent seeking a pure, high-value, single-ingredient treat to supplement their pet's main diet. If you are looking to provide a rich, natural source of omega-3s and protein as a special reward or dietary booster, this brand is a compelling choice. Those needing a complete and balanced daily meal for their cat should look to more traditional food formats. A practical tip for buyers: Given the high concentration and cost, think of this product in terms of "cost per treat" rather than "cost per pound." A four-pound bag of freeze-dried krill will last an exceptionally long time when used as a light supplement or occasional reward for a cat, which can help put the premium price tag into a more manageable context.

Frequently asked questions about Aquatic Foods Inc.

Is Aquatic Foods Inc. krill a complete meal for my cat?

No, this product should be considered a supplementary treat or food topper. It is not fortified with the complete spectrum of vitamins, minerals, and taurine that cats require for a balanced daily diet.

Why is this krill so much more expensive than regular cat food?

The high price is due to it being a 100% single-ingredient product that undergoes a costly freeze-drying process. You are paying for the purity, nutritional density, and processing of whole krill, not for bulk fillers like corn or wheat.

Is this product really for fish and cats?

Yes, the product is marketed towards a variety of carnivorous animals, including large aquarium fish, turtles, and domestic cats, who can all benefit from the nutrients in krill. As with any treat, it should be given in moderation.

Is Aquatic Foods Inc. krill grain-free?

Yes, because the product consists of 100% freeze-dried krill, it is inherently free from grains, corn, soy, and other plant-based fillers commonly found in traditional pet foods.
